What companies run services between Washington Hilton, DC, USA and Washington Dulles Airport (IAD), USA?

Washington Metropolitan Area Transit Authority operates a subway from Farragut West, Blue/Orange/Silver Line Track 2 Platform to Washington Dulles International Airport, Silver Line Center Platform every 15 minutes. Tickets cost $2–3 and the journey takes 47 min.
